
What are the components of adjustable steel supports?

1. Adjustable steel support upper inner pipe (pipe length can be customized according to adjustable height requirements, with equidistant adjustment holes drilled on the pipe to meet size adjustments)
2. Adjustable steel support lower outer tube (the length of the adjustable steel support tube can be customized according to requirements and used in conjunction with the inner tube. Considering cost-effectiveness in processing materials, the length is generally shorter than that of the upper inner tube)
3. Adjustable steel support threaded pipe nut (mainly welded on the top of the lower outer pipe, used in combination with the threaded pipe and nut for small size adjustment, beneficial for dismantling the steel support) Top support (there are many types of top support, commonly used including plum blossom support, U-shaped support, square corner support, flat head support, etc.) Base (has good fixing support function, drilled with four holes, commonly in plum blossom and square shapes).
In terms of material, the adjustable steel support is made of Q235 steel, which has strong hardness, high bearing capacity, longer service life, and is more convenient for construction and disassembly. Compared with traditional wooden supports, it is more environmentally friendly, has a large construction space, and is conducive to the transportation of materials on construction sites.
